An Overview on BSNL Bharat Fiber

BSNL’s Bharat Fiber (FTTH) is a cutting-edge technology that delivers high-speed broadband over a fiber network with unlimited bandwidth. This state-of-the-art fixed access platform offers speeds ranging from 2 Mbps to 300 Mbps, supporting high-definition IPTV, a variety of telephony services, and comprehensive internet solutions. Bharat Fiber is designed to provide a robust IP-based solution, enabling services like IP leased lines, internet access, Closed User Group (CUG), MPLS-VPN, VoIP, video conferencing, video calls, and much more. With bandwidth on demand, Bharat Fiber allows seamless upgrades without the need to change fiber connections or home devices. 

Connectivity with Bharat Fiber (FTTH): 

BSNL connects fiber directly from the nearest Central Office (CO) location to customer premises, either through direct deployment or via franchise partners. Upon installation, BSNL provides a Home Optical Network Terminal (HONT) and battery backup at the customer’s location. Services such as Voice, Broadband, and IPTV are activated according to the customer’s chosen plan. 

Services Offered via Bharat Fiber (FTTH): 

High-Speed Internet: Controlled and uncontrolled internet speeds from 256 Kbps to 1000 Mbps. 

TV Over IP Service (MPEG2): IPTV services with diverse content options. 

Video on Demand (VoD): MPEG4 streaming with VCR-like functionality. 

Audio on Demand Service: Stream audio content based on demand. 

Bandwidth on Demand: Configurable by the user or service provider. 

Remote Education: Enables virtual learning experiences. 

Video Conferencing and Virtual Classrooms: Supports point-to-point and multi-point conferencing. 

Voice and Video Telephony Over IP: Connections managed by centralized soft switches. 

Interactive Gaming: Seamless, high-speed gaming experiences. 

VPN on Broadband: Secure network solutions for businesses and personal users. 

Dial-up VPN Service: Remote, secure VPN access. 

Virtual Private LAN Service (VPLS): Virtual LAN connectivity for secure, private networking. 

Bharat Fiber (FTTH) by BSNL delivers comprehensive digital connectivity, offering tailored solutions to meet various high-speed internet, entertainment, and communication needs.
